Output 51b136145465f64d8176eeb6fba14a4ab3d3863a7d65235ffb0f5a6a0352ad9f:0

value
29000451
script pubkey
OP_0 OP_PUSHBYTES_20 383a921bf90fb59dfb9d7cbedd217150fe68c6c6
address
ltc1q8qafyxlep76em7ua0jld6gt32rlx33kxheayw7
transaction
51b136145465f64d8176eeb6fba14a4ab3d3863a7d65235ffb0f5a6a0352ad9f
spent
true